As a freelancer, you’re a one-person show juggling client work, marketing, and—let’s be honest—the not-so-fun task of managing your finances. Whether you’re a writer, designer, or consultant, keeping track of invoices, expenses, and taxes can feel like a second job. I remember my first year freelancing as a graphic designer; I spent hours wrestling with spreadsheets, only to realize I’d missed a tax deduction for my new laptop. Ouch. That’s when I knew I needed accounting software to save my sanity—and my wallet.
In 2025, the right accounting tools can transform your freelance business from chaotic to organized, saving you time and helping you look professional. But with so many options out there, how do you choose? This guide dives into the top accounting software for freelancers, backed by research, expert insights, and real-life examples. We’ll explore features, pricing, and what makes each tool stand out, all while keeping it conversational and easy to digest. Ready to take control of your finances? Let’s dive in.
Why Freelancers Need Accounting Software
Freelancing is freeing, but it comes with unique financial challenges. Unlike traditional employees, you’re responsible for tracking income, managing expenses, and staying tax-compliant. According to a 2024 Upwork study, 59% of freelancers spend over 10 hours a month on administrative tasks like bookkeeping. That’s time you could spend landing new clients or, you know, living your life.
Accounting software automates repetitive tasks, ensures accurate records, and helps you avoid costly mistakes. Imagine sending a polished invoice in seconds or having your expenses categorized for tax season. Plus, with HMRC’s Making Tax Digital (MTD) requirements in the UK and similar regulations elsewhere, cloud-based tools make compliance a breeze. Let’s explore the must-have features to look for and the best tools to get the job done.
Key Features to Look for in Freelancer Accounting Software
Before we jump into the top picks, let’s talk about what makes great accounting software for freelancers. Here’s a quick checklist of features to prioritize:
- User-Friendly Interface: You’re not an accountant, so the software should be intuitive and jargon-free.
- Invoicing and Billing: Create professional invoices, automate reminders, and accept online payments.
- Expense Tracking: Automatically categorize expenses and scan receipts on the go.
- Tax Compliance: Support for VAT, Self-Assessment, or IRS filings, with real-time tax estimates.
- Time Tracking: Link billable hours to invoices for project-based work.
- Bank Integration: Sync with your bank for seamless transaction imports.
- Mobile Access: Manage finances from anywhere with a robust mobile app.
- Affordability: Budget-friendly plans for solo entrepreneurs.
With these in mind, let’s break down the best accounting software for freelancers in 2025, based on ease of use, features, and value.
Top 7 Accounting Software for Freelancers in 2025
1. FreshBooks: The All-Rounder for Service-Based Freelancers
FreshBooks is a favorite among freelancers for its intuitive design and robust features tailored to service-based businesses. Whether you’re a writer, photographer, or consultant, FreshBooks makes invoicing, expense tracking, and time management a breeze. I once had a client who raved about how professional my FreshBooks invoices looked compared to my old PayPal ones—it’s a game-changer for client impressions.
Key Features
- Customizable Invoicing: Create branded invoices with automatic payment reminders.
- Time Tracking: Track billable hours and link them directly to invoices.
- Expense Management: Scan receipts via the mobile app and categorize expenses effortlessly.
- Client Portals: Clients can view invoices, make payments, and communicate in one place.
- Tax Support: Generates reports for easy tax filing, including MTD compliance for UK freelancers.
Pricing
- Lite: $19/month (up to 5 clients)
- Plus: $33/month (up to 50 clients)
- Premium: $60/month (unlimited clients)
- 30-day free trial available
Why It’s Great
FreshBooks shines for its user-friendly interface and excellent customer support. A 2025 PCMag review praised its “intuitive, attractive double-entry accounting experience” for freelancers. It’s ideal if you want a tool that grows with your business without overwhelming you with complexity.
Best For
Service-based freelancers who prioritize ease of use and professional invoicing.
2. QuickBooks Self-Employed: The Tax-Savvy Choice
QuickBooks Self-Employed is designed specifically for freelancers and independent contractors. It’s perfect if tax season stresses you out, with features like automatic mileage tracking and quarterly tax estimates. When I started using QuickBooks, I was amazed at how it flagged deductible expenses I’d overlooked, saving me hundreds at tax time.
Key Features
- Mileage Tracking: Automatically logs business trips via GPS.
- Tax Estimates: Calculates quarterly tax payments to avoid surprises.
- Invoicing: Send professional invoices with online payment options.
- Expense Categorization: Separates business and personal expenses with bank integration.
- HMRC Compliance: Supports UK Self-Assessment and VAT filings.
Pricing
- Self-Employed: $20/month
- Self-Employed Tax Bundle: $30/month (includes TurboTax integration)
- 30-day free trial
Why It’s Great
QuickBooks is a trusted name, used by millions of freelancers worldwide. A 2024 NerdWallet review highlighted its “strong invoicing features and automatic mileage tracking” as standout benefits. It’s especially useful for US freelancers needing IRS Schedule C support or UK freelancers navigating Self-Assessment.
Best For
Freelancers who want robust tax tools and mileage tracking.
3. Wave: The Budget-Friendly Powerhouse
If you’re bootstrapping your freelance business, Wave is a fantastic free option. It offers unlimited invoicing and expense tracking, with no hidden fees for core features. A friend of mine, a freelance writer, swears by Wave for its simplicity—she set it up in minutes and never looked back.
Key Features
- Free Invoicing: Unlimited invoices with customizable templates.
- Expense Tracking: Scan receipts and categorize expenses via the mobile app.
- Accounting Reports: Generate profit and loss statements for tax season.
- Payment Processing: Competitive rates starting at 1% per transaction.
- Multi-Currency Support: Ideal for freelancers with international clients.
Pricing
- Free for invoicing and accounting
- Pro Plan: $16/month for advanced features like bank transaction imports
- Payment processing fees apply
Why It’s Great
Wave’s free plan is a lifesaver for new freelancers. A 2025 Evercast review called it “second-to-none” for its free invoicing and accounting capabilities. It’s perfect if you’re starting out or managing a small client base on a tight budget.
Best For
New freelancers or those with simple accounting needs.
4. Zoho Books: The Scalable Solution
Zoho Books is a versatile choice for freelancers who want affordable, feature-rich software that scales as their business grows. Its mobile app is a standout, letting you manage finances on the go. A freelance photographer I know uses Zoho Books to track project expenses across multiple clients, and she loves its affordability.
Key Features
- Project Accounting: Track income and expenses by project.
- Mobile App: Record billable hours, create invoices, and accept payments from your phone.
- Automation: Auto-categorize expenses and set recurring invoices.
- Free Plan: For freelancers earning under $50,000 annually.
- Integrations: Connects with PayPal, Stripe, and other tools.
Pricing
- Free: For annual revenue under $50,000
- Standard: $20/month
- Professional: $50/month
- Free trial available
Why It’s Great
Zoho Books balances affordability with advanced features. A 2025 Fit Small Business review named it the “overall best freelancer accounting software” for its project accounting and mobile app. It’s ideal for freelancers who juggle multiple projects and need scalability.
Best For
Project-based freelancers looking for affordable, robust software.
5. Xero: The Global Freelancer’s Pick
Xero is a cloud-based powerhouse perfect for freelancers with international clients or those needing collaboration with accountants. Its clean interface and automation features make it a top choice for UK and Australian freelancers. I spoke with a freelance developer who uses Xero to manage multi-currency invoices, and he said it’s saved him hours each month.
Key Features
- Multi-Currency Support: Handle international transactions seamlessly.
- Bank Feeds: Automatic transaction imports for reconciliation.
- Unlimited Users: Collaborate with your accountant at no extra cost.
- Inventory Management: Useful for freelancers selling physical goods.
- MTD Compliance: Direct integration with HMRC for VAT filings.
Pricing
- Early: $15/month
- Growing: $42/month
- Established: $78/month
- 30-day free trial
Why It’s Great
Xero’s cloud-based accessibility and unlimited users make it ideal for growing businesses. A 2025 Simply Business review praised its “seamless bank feeds and app integrations” for UK freelancers. It’s a great fit if you want a tool that evolves with your business.
Best For
Freelancers with international clients or those needing accountant collaboration.
6. FreeAgent: The UK Freelancer’s Dream
FreeAgent is tailored for UK freelancers, with features designed to simplify Self-Assessment and VAT compliance. It’s especially popular among those banking with NatWest or Royal Bank of Scotland, as it’s free with certain accounts. A UK-based freelance marketer I know uses FreeAgent to file VAT returns directly to HMRC, calling it a “lifesaver” for compliance.
Key Features
- HMRC Integration: Submit VAT returns and Self-Assessment filings directly.
- Time Tracking: Log billable hours and add them to invoices.
- Expense Management: Upload receipt photos via the mobile app.
- Real-Time Tax Estimates: Stay on top of your tax obligations.
- Bank Integration: Syncs with UK banks for automatic transaction imports.
Pricing
- Free with NatWest, Mettle, or Royal Bank of Scotland accounts
- Standard: £24/month
- 30-day free trial
Why It’s Great
FreeAgent’s focus on UK tax compliance makes it a top choice for UK freelancers. A 2025 ProTaxPlus review highlighted its “automatic tax calculations and MTD compatibility” as key strengths. It’s perfect if you want a tool that handles UK-specific tax requirements.
Best For
UK freelancers needing MTD-compliant software.
7. Collective: The Premium All-in-One Solution
Collective is a unique option for high-earning freelancers (over $80,000 annually) who want to form an S-Corp for tax savings. It combines accounting software with CPA support, making it ideal for US freelancers looking to streamline taxes and bookkeeping. A freelance consultant I interviewed said Collective’s expert guidance saved her thousands in taxes.
Key Features
- S-Corp Support: Helps set up and manage an S-Corp for tax savings.
- Bookkeeping Services: CPA-backed bookkeeping and tax advice.
- Invoicing and Expenses: Comprehensive financial management tools.
- Tax Filing: Handles federal and state tax filings.
- Dedicated Support: Access to financial experts year-round.
Pricing
- Starts at $299/month (varies based on services)
- Free consultation available
Why It’s Great
Collective’s all-in-one approach is perfect for high-earning freelancers who want to offload financial tasks. A 2024 Millo review noted its “potential for significant tax savings” through S-Corp election. It’s a premium choice but worth it for those prioritizing tax optimization.
Best For
High-earning US freelancers seeking tax savings and expert support.
How to Choose the Right Accounting Software for You
With so many options, picking the right software can feel overwhelming. Here’s a step-by-step guide to make it easier:
- Assess Your Needs: Are you a new freelancer needing basic invoicing, or do you juggle multiple clients and projects? Identify your must-have features.
- Consider Your Budget: Free options like Wave are great for beginners, while paid tools like FreshBooks or QuickBooks offer more features.
- Check Tax Requirements: If you’re in the UK, prioritize MTD-compliant software like FreeAgent or Xero. For US freelancers, look for IRS Schedule C support.
- Test Mobile Access: If you’re always on the go, choose software with a strong mobile app, like Zoho Books or FreshBooks.
- Try Before You Buy: Most tools offer free trials, so test a few to see which feels intuitive.
Pro tip: Talk to other freelancers in your niche. I once joined a Reddit thread where freelancers shared their experiences with Wave versus FreshBooks, and it helped me decide which tool fit my workflow.
Expert Insights: Why Accounting Software Matters
To add some expert perspective, I reached out to Sarah Johnson, a CPA with 10 years of experience working with freelancers. She emphasized that “accounting software isn’t just about saving time—it’s about avoiding costly mistakes. I’ve seen freelancers miss deductions or face penalties because they relied on spreadsheets. Tools like QuickBooks or Zoho Books catch errors and keep you compliant.”
Sarah also pointed out that automation is a game-changer. “Features like bank feeds and expense categorization reduce human error. For freelancers, this means more time to focus on what they love—whether that’s designing, writing, or consulting.”
Real-Life Example: How Accounting Software Saved a Freelancer
Let me share a story about my friend Alex, a freelance video editor. Alex used to track his income and expenses in a messy Google Sheet. One year, he forgot to log a $1,200 camera purchase as a business expense, missing out on a hefty tax deduction. Frustrated, he switched to FreshBooks after a colleague’s recommendation. Within weeks, he was sending professional invoices, tracking expenses via the mobile app, and getting real-time tax estimates. By the next tax season, he saved over $2,000 in deductions and cut his bookkeeping time in half. Alex’s story shows how the right software can make a tangible difference.